I installed BIAB 2018 on my Dell computer running windows 10 and have some issues. When I start BIAB I get a popup window at the bottom right that says "Windows Audio Session Error: Could not select the default input device. The error number is -9985". Never saw this with BIAB 2017. When I load an existing song that worked on 2017 when I play it there is a delay in the display changing chords and they are not in sync with the audio. On a fast song it is about 2 beats delayed and on a slow waltz it is about 1 beat late.

Another more serious problem is after I install the program I can run it and close it and start it up again without any problem but if I shut the computer down and start it up again then I can't run BIAB again without re-installing it. I get an error that says "bbw.exe - Bad Image, ****.dll is either not designed to run on windows or it contains an error", *** is the full file path and it repeats this error for 3 different .dlls I have re-installed the program and installed the updates 3 times with the same result each time.

Hello and welcome to the forum. The first error was seen in early versions of BIAB 2018 but was fixed with a patch. Go to the grey Support tab above and download and install the latest build. If you’ve done that, go to Options, Preferences, Audio and change From WAS driver to MME or, if you have it, ASIO.

About the second problem, try locating BBW.EXE in the /BB folder, right click and select Run as Administrator. If that doesn’t work, turn off your antivirus program during the install.

We encountered a similar problem a few months ago, where McAfee (on certain computers) was deleting .dll's, without any notification. It would leave a 0 byte dll file in the Band-in-a-Box folder that was not a valid dll, so the program would give errors like this. I think you can exclude the Band-in-a-Box folder in the Mcafee settings (if that's indeed what your issue is), but you likely need to reinstall Band-in-a-Box (just the main program file) to get the files back.

You are correct in that the file C:\bb\data\lib\dllelasttiquePro.dll had 0 bytes in it. I copied that file from the BIAB hard drive and BIAB then loaded just fine. I suspect you are right that McAfee is killing it. Now if I can just find out how to stop McAfee from killing it.
